Best book of the year was "Saints of Whistle Grove" -- hands down. I'm kind of amazed that I haven't already read it another time or two.
Keating murder mysteries were very enjoyable even though that's not normally a genre I read. The Lutheran setting and the theological/moral perspective was great (without being at all preachy). I'm looking forward to continuing the series. I did need a little break, though, from all the BadGuyStuff.
The Aug-Sept books were pretty good. The Kindle freebies (Nov-Dec) weren't bad.
